The upcoming Eastern General Hospital (EGH) aims to provide excellent healthcare and promote healing centered around each person. When operational, EGH will provide a comprehensive range of inpatient and outpatient clinical specialties and healthcare services, covering emergency, acute and secondary care. EGH’s vision is to be a hospital for the community and a great workplace for staff. It seeks to do so by harnessing innovative technologies in patient care, journeying closely with patients and the community to lead healthier and more fulfilling lives, and being an employer of choice that empowers staff in their careers.
In this role, you will be part of the SingHealth Operational Technology (OpTech) Team, which provides comprehensive support for Medical Devices and Operation Technology Systems (MDOTS) and SingHealth-managed systems. Amid accelerated digitalisation and the rapid adoption of advanced healthcare technologies such as robotics and artificial intelligence, the healthcare landscape continues to evolve. Operational technology plays a critical role in enabling safe, secure, and compliant healthcare delivery to meet future demands.
The incumbent will play a key role in overseeing the security and compliance aspects of the procurement, evaluation, and deployment of cluster and institution-managed ICT and OpTech solutions. This includes supporting OpTech and CIO Office initiatives across SingHealth, ensuring alignment with organisational policies, regulatory requirements, and established governance processes.
